but off of the top of my head, the easiest one would be to use tailscale. it's a private VPN. install this app on your node and set it up on your phone. then add your relay to your nostr profile. i.e. wss://start9-node-name:1234 and then you'd need to launch your tailscale each time you want to connect to your own relay before you launch your nostr client.
the harder way, the way it do it, so i don't have to launch a VPN each time i connect to my node, requires some knowledge of command line and port forwarding on your router. if you want to go that route i can help later. heading to fireworks now.
